Technical Specifications

Side-by-side comparison of Pentium G3450 and Phenom II X4 920

Intel

Pentium G3450

The Pentium G3450 is manufactured by Intel. It was released in 1 May 2014 (11 years ago). It is based on the Haswell (2013−2015) architecture. It features 2 cores and 2 threads. Base frequency is 3.4 GHz, with boost up to 3.3 GHz. L3 cache: 3 MB (total). L2 cache: 256 kB (per core). Built on 22 nm process technology. Socket: LGA1150. Thermal design power (TDP): 53 Watt. Memory support: DDR3. Passmark benchmark score: 2,182 points. Launch price was $175.

AMD

Phenom II X4 920

The Phenom II X4 920 is manufactured by AMD. It was released in 8 January 2009 (16 years ago). It is based on the Deneb (2009−2011) architecture. It features 4 cores and 4 threads. Base frequency is 2.8 GHz, with boost up to 2.8 GHz. L3 cache: 6 MB (total). L2 cache: 512 kB (per core). Built on 45 nm process technology. Socket: AM3. Thermal design power (TDP): 125 Watt. Memory support: DDR3. Passmark benchmark score: 2,202 points. Launch price was $90.

Processing Power

The Pentium G3450 packs 2 cores / 2 threads, while the Phenom II X4 920 offers 4 cores / 4 threads — the Phenom II X4 920 has 2 more cores. Boost clocks reach 3.3 GHz on the Pentium G3450 versus 2.8 GHz on the Phenom II X4 920 — a 16.4% clock advantage for the Pentium G3450 (base: 3.4 GHz vs 2.8 GHz). The Pentium G3450 uses the Haswell (2013−2015) architecture (22 nm), while the Phenom II X4 920 uses Deneb (2009−2011) (45 nm). In PassMark, the Pentium G3450 scores 2,182 against the Phenom II X4 920's 2,202 — a 0.9% lead for the Phenom II X4 920. L3 cache: 3 MB (total) on the Pentium G3450 vs 6 MB (total) on the Phenom II X4 920.
